Nick Sirianni’s Ultimate Redemption Story – From The Chants Of ‘Fire Sirianni’ To The Super Bowl 59 Victory

Eric Divakaran

The Philadelphia Eagles just won the Super Bowl trophy in a spectacular fashion and they knocked the Chiefs off of their high horses. Their defense was phenomenal and their offense matched their defensive effort. The Eagles were amazing on both sides of the field and the players showed up. The Eagles just were much more hungrier than the Chiefs and it showed.

The Chiefs and Andy Reid were left speechless as their star quarterback had one of the worst games of his career. Mahomes was sacked 6 times and hit 11 times. While his stats look like he showed up, it came mostly after the game was already over.

This Eagles’ win in the Super Bowl happened because of the players but let’s not forget about their head coach Nick Sirianni. What a journey it has been for Sirianni himself. He’s been coaching the Eagles since 2021 and in his first five season, he’s already been to two Super Bowls and won one against a team that were trying to three-peat. The coach has experienced it all. From being in the Super Bowl and losing. To getting knocked off the playoffs in the early stages, and now winning a Super Bowl. Nick Sirianni was once on the hotseat!

There were multiple reports that stated the Eagles may have potentially fired Sirianni after this season, if he had failed to go deep into the playoffs. In fact, many fans also wanted Sirianni gone from the Eagles. They started slow with a 2-2 record and that set even more fuel to the fire. ESPN Analyst, Damien Woody, called him a “clown.” Now here Sirianni is, after winning the Super Bowl. What are they going to say now?

Fans and analysts are quick to call out coaches and players if they lose but have nothing to say when they win. It has always been that way. It’s easy to sit, watch, and complain about the team losing and not think of winning as a process. Sirianni took this team to the Super Bowls in 2022 and there were high praises for him during that time. Then came the 2023 season and they all wanted Sirianni fired. Now, it’s the coach’s turn to say something back and he did. He got home the Super Bowl trophy and that is something you can never take away from him. This shows how quickly narratives and agendas can change.

Only the players believed in Sirianni and that was all he needed. The rest was just noise he chose to ignore. Talk about a redemption arc!

How did Nick Sirianni do it: How did he beat the Chiefs?

The biggest question in the NFL was if any team, across the league, could beat the Chiefs and stop them from three-peating. We saw the Bills fail, the Texans fail, and even the Ravens had no answer this season. So what did Sirianni do that others could not?

For starters, how about coach Sirianni’s energy? Win or lose, he is one of the most passionate coaches we have ever seen and it was even seen today. The Eagles were already up in the game, by a wide margin, and Sirianni still had a shouting match with his receiver A.J. Brown. When the Eagles beat the Commanders in the AFC Championship round, instead of taking any credit, he praised his quarterback the most.

Coach Sirianni and defensive coordinator, Vic Fangio, simply decided to bring the locks with them to the field. They absolutely clamped down the Chiefs’ offense and there is no debating around that. Fumbles, sacks, and pick-six, was the name of the game. Can you imagine a team with Patrick Mahomes, held scoreless for three quarters? We didn’t but that’s what happened. The irony around all this is, Sirianni started his NFL coaching career with the Chiefs and he came back to beat them.

How many Super Bowls has Nick Sirianni won in his coaching career?

With his win with the Eagles in the 2025 Super Bowl, Nick Sirianni has won his first ever championship as a head coach. He is the first Eagles’ head coach to reach two Super Bowls and only the second coach in team history to win the Super Bowl trophy.

Beating the Chiefs is no small feat and only Sirianni, Zac Taylor, and the great Bill Belichick has beaten the Chiefs in the playoffs so far. From losing in the Super Bowl to winning it all. Nick Sirianni may already be the best coach the Eagles have ever had!
